Winemaker Notes

A classic example of what this variety can achieve in a warm maritime climate.Made in an unwooded style to retain and enhance varietal fruit freshness. Staggeredharvesting of fruit from a combination of estate sites and trellising systems allowsexpression of a spectrum of aromas and flavours from sweet grassiness to punchyripe citrus in the finished wine. This complexity also provides exceptional structureand palate weight with considerable ageing potential. Cellaring for five or moreyears is rewarded with rich complex nut, straw and toast characters in harmony withripe lemon and sweet grassy nuances while still retaining a pleasantly surprisinglevel of freshness, vibrancy and length.

Sémillon has the power to create wines with considerable structure, depth and length that will improve for several decades. It is the perfect partner to the vivdly aromatic Sauvignon Blanc. Sémillon especially shines in the Bordeaux region of Sauternes, which produces some of the world’s greatest sweet wines. Somm Secret—Sémillon was so common in South Africa in the 1820s, covering 93% of the country’s vineyard area, it was simply referred to as Wyndruif, or “wine grape.”

Margaret River

Western Australia

View all products

Home to some of Australia’s most elegant and long-lived red and white wines, Margaret River is situated in the farthest reaches of Western Australia. Relatively warm and dry, the region is cooled by breezes from the Indian Ocean. Margaret River takes some inspiration from Bordeaux, producing top-quality Cabernet Sauvignons and Bordeaux Blends with firm structure, mouthwatering acidity, balanced alcohol and notes of herbs and spice. For white wines, refreshing blends of Sauvignon Blanc and Semillon as well as complex, age-worthy Chardonnays are regional specialties.
